交互升级+实时响应:运营中心小程序高效测试秘籍
|
本图基于AI算法,仅供参考 在数字化运营浪潮中,运营中心小程序已成为企业触达用户、提升服务效率的核心工具。然而,随着用户对交互体验和响应速度的要求日益严苛,传统测试方法已难以满足高效迭代的开发需求。如何通过“交互升级+实时响应”双轮驱动,实现小程序测试的降本增效?本文将从测试策略、技术工具、流程优化三个维度,拆解运营中心小程序高效测试的实战秘籍。交互升级的核心在于“模拟真实场景”。传统测试往往聚焦功能验证,却忽略用户实际使用路径的多样性。例如,用户可能在弱网环境下操作、频繁切换页面或同时触发多个功能,这些场景若未被覆盖,极易导致上线后出现卡顿、闪退等问题。因此,测试团队需构建“场景化测试矩阵”,将用户行为拆解为高频操作(如搜索、支付)、边界操作(如空数据加载、超限输入)和异常操作(如断网重连、权限变更),通过自动化脚本模拟用户真实操作轨迹,覆盖90%以上的交互路径。同时,引入视觉回归测试工具,对页面布局、动画效果进行像素级比对,确保交互升级后的视觉一致性,避免因UI错位影响用户体验。 实时响应的测试重点在于“全链路性能监控”。运营中心小程序通常涉及多服务端接口调用,任何一个环节的延迟都可能拖累整体响应速度。测试团队需搭建“端到端性能监控体系”,通过模拟高并发场景(如秒杀活动、消息推送),监测小程序从用户点击到服务端返回的全链路耗时。使用APM工具(如Sentry、New Relic)定位性能瓶颈,结合日志分析,快速定位是前端渲染、网络传输还是后端服务导致的延迟。例如,某电商小程序通过性能测试发现,商品详情页的加载时间过长,根源在于图片未做CDN加速和懒加载优化,调整后页面打开速度提升60%,用户流失率显著下降。 自动化测试是提升效率的关键手段,但需避免“为自动化而自动化”。运营中心小程序功能迭代频繁,若自动化脚本维护成本过高,反而会拖慢测试节奏。建议采用“分层自动化策略”:核心流程(如登录、下单)使用UI自动化工具(如Appium、Selenium)实现全覆盖;次要功能(如个人中心、设置)采用接口自动化测试,减少前端变更对脚本的影响;临时需求(如节日活动页)则通过手动测试快速验证。引入AI辅助测试工具,通过机器学习自动生成测试用例,识别页面元素变化,将脚本维护成本降低40%以上。 测试环境与生产环境的差异是导致“测试通过但上线崩溃”的常见原因。为缩小环境差距,可采用“容器化部署+流量镜像”方案:将测试环境部署在Docker容器中,确保与生产环境的操作系统、依赖库版本一致;通过流量镜像技术,将生产环境的真实请求按比例复制到测试环境,模拟真实用户行为。例如,某金融小程序通过流量镜像测试发现,在特定时间段的并发请求会导致数据库连接池耗尽,优化后系统稳定性提升3倍,避免了重大线上事故。 高效测试的终极目标是“预防缺陷而非发现缺陷”。运营中心小程序测试需从“被动验证”转向“主动设计”,在需求评审阶段介入,基于用户画像和历史数据预判潜在风险点;在开发阶段推行“测试左移”,通过单元测试、代码扫描提前拦截低级错误;在上线阶段实施“灰度发布+A/B测试”,小流量验证功能稳定性后再全量推送。通过构建覆盖全生命周期的质量保障体系,将缺陷发现率提升70%,测试周期缩短50%,真正实现“交互升级”与“实时响应”的双重目标。 (编辑:92站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

